Soboń: 15th pension would be a big burden on state budget

Soboń: 15th pension would be a big burden on state budget
Source: Pixabay

The payment of the 15th pension would be too big of a burden for the state budget, Deputy Finance Minister Artur Soboń said.

Soboń confirmed on the air of Zet radio that the budget will not withstand the payment of the 15th pension.

In late August, President Andrzej Duda said that if a 15th pension was needed, it should be considered. Last week, the media reported that the 15th pension would be paid in 2023. The chair of the Executive Committee of Law and Justice Krzysztof Sobolewski denied this information.
